Simplifying Cuboid Math: Mastering the Basics with Ease
What you'll learn
- 1. The students will learn what a cuboid is.
- 2. Students will learn how to calculate the volume, total surface area, and lateral surface area of a cuboid.
- 3. They will also understand how to calculate the area of four walls of a room.
- 4. They will also learn how to calculate the length of diagonal of a cuboid.
